On average across the year,
no, Greenland is not hotter than
Apple Valley, Minnesota
.
Greenland has an average temperature of -2°C/28°F and Apple Valley, Minnesota has an average temperature of 9°C/48°F.
Greenland's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 12°C/54°F, which is not hotter than Apple Valley, Minnesota's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 29°C/84°F).
On average across the year, yes, Greenland is colder than Apple Valley, Minnesota . Greenland has an average minimum temperature of -5°C/23°F and Apple Valley, Minnesota has an average minimum temperature of 4°C/39°F.
